๐Ÿ‡ช๐Ÿ‡บ๐Ÿ‡จ๐Ÿ‡ณ Notice on Airline Boarding Requirements for Certificates of Negative Nucleic Acid and Anti-body Blood Tests Results

In order to reduce the cross-border transmission of COVID-19, starting from November 6, 2020, all foreign passengers flying from Cyprus to China will be required to take both the PCR and IgM anti-body tests and then apply for a certified Health Decalration Form before boarding the flight. The specific requirements are as follows:

I. Test Requirements

Passengers flying from Cyprus to China via third countries must take both the PCR and IgM anti-body tests in Cyprus within 48 hours before boarding the flight to the transit country and then take both tests again in the transit country (the last stop country before China) within 48 hours before boarding. Passengers must apply at the Chinese Embassy/Consulate in BOTH countries for certified Health Declaration Forms with negative results of BOTH tests.

It should be noted that the standard of 48 hours is the sampling time, instead of the result issuing time.

II. Foreign Passengers Applying for Certified Health Declaraion Form

Foreign passengers must email the scanned copies of their negative PCR and IgM anti-body tests results, passport information page and the signed Health Declaration Form to the the email box of the Chinese Embassy in Cyprus: [email protected]. The PCR and IgM anti-body test reports should be submitted no later than 12 hours before boarding in order for the Chinese Embassy to examine and verify the reports. The Chinese Embassy will examine and verify the results and email back the stamped and certified Health Declaration Form. Passengers are requested to print the form out and bring it to the airport of Cyprus.

Moreover, the working staff of the direct flight from the transit country to China will again check the passengersโ€™ certified Health Declaration Form issued by the Chinese Embassy/Consulate in the transit country. Passengers are advised to learn the specific application procedures of the Chinese Embassy/Consulate in the transit country, pay attention to the validity period of the declaration form and cooperate with the airlinesโ€™ checking when boarding.

It should be noted that international direct flights from the transit country to Beijing will only admit the citizens of that country and the Chinese citizens residing in that country. Therefore, passengers from other countries will not be allowed to board. For example, only Greek citizens and Chinese citizens residing in Greece are allowed to board the flight from Athens to Beijing. Cypriot citizens will not be allowed to board that flight. International direct flights from the transit country to other cities in China remain unaffected.

III. Reminder

A. Please read the requirements carefully and follow them accordingly. Failure to obtain the certified Health Declaration Form with negative PCR and IgM anti-body test results means you are not qualifed for boarding the flight to China and you have to change your itinerary.

B. Please check beforehand the transit countryโ€™s entry policy and its PCR and IgM anti-body tests requirements. If there is no fast test at the airport of the transit country, you have to apply for a entry visa of the transit country in order to take both tests.

C. The list of labs recognized by the Chinese Embassy in Cyprus is as follows, and the test report should contain accurate name, passport number and seal of the labs.

Please also learn about the recognised labs in the transit country and the testing report requirements of the Chinese Embassy/Consulate in the transit country, and make an appointment with the labs in advance.

D. Sefarers bound for China must complete a PCR test and an IgM anti-body test 48 hours before boarding the ships and obtain double negative reports.

The Chinese Embassy in Cyprus kindly reminds passengers to declare their personal information truthfully, carry out tests at the labs recognized by the Embassy, and provide authentic and effective PCR and IgM anti-body test reports. The Embassy does not recognize test reports produced by labs outside of the list(see below). In case of intentional concealment of illness, alteration and falsification of PCR and IgM anti-body test reports, relevant personnel will be held accountable in accordance with the law. Please give careful and due consideration while making travel plans to China, pay close attention to the information release of the transit countries and local Chinese embassies/consulates, so as to avoid being held up or repatriated due to inability to enter the country for tests.
